Senior Year.
Mining.—Ventilation, Natural and Artificial; Measurement of Ventilation and Work done by Ventilators.
page 43Accidents—Fires in Mines, etc.
Mechanical Preparation of Ores; Stamps, Mills, Separators, Jigging Machines, etc.; Washing and Dressing of Coal, etc.
General Management of Mines, etc.
Engineering.—Prime Movers; Study of Water-wheels and Turbines; Steam Engines and Boilers; Designs and Estimates.
Chemistry.—Quantitative Analysis of Ores, Coals, Fire Clays, Pig Iron, Slags, etc.
Assaying.—Lectures and Laboratory Practice, Ores of Lead, Silver. Gold. Tin, Antimony. Copper, Nickel, Cobalt, Gold and Silver Bullion.
Economic Geology.—Occurrence and Distribution of Ores; Iron, Lead, Copper, etc.; Character, Uses and Distribution of Coal, Lignite, Peat, Petroleum, Salt, Clays, Building Stones, Fertilizers, etc.
Metallurgy.—Copper: Swedish, English and Mixed Methods; Extraction by Wet Way.
Zinc—English, Belgian and Silesian Processes; Manufacture of Oxide.
Lead—Description of Various Processes; Extraction of Silver from Lead; Pattisonage; Zinc Method; Cupellation.
Silver—Amalgamation; Smelting; Extraction by Wet Way.
Gold—Washing; Amalgamation; Smelting; Extraction by Wet Way.
Tin—Preparation of Ores; German and Cornish Methods of Extraction.
Metallurgy of Platinum, Aluminum, Mercury, Arsenic, Antimony. Bismuth, Nickel. Cobalt.
Examination of Metallurgical Works.
Blowpipe Analysis.—Quantitative; Lectures and Laboratory Practice; Assay of Ores of Gold. Silver, Lead, Copper, etc.
Mechanics.—Rankine's Applied Mechanics; Stress. Kinematics, Mechanism, Dynamics.
Drawing.—Machines, Furnaces, Mines, etc.
Projects.—Plans for the Establishment and working of Mines and Smelting Works, under given conditions, with drawings, Estimates and Written Memoirs.
page 44Shop-work.—Work in the Machine Shop.
English Composition.—Themes.
